I just tried to compile 9.0.6 on a Solaris 11.3 box (but using GCC 5.4.0
and MySQL) with these options:
CFLAGS="-g -m64" LDFLAGS="-m64" CXXFLAGS="-m64" ./configure \
--prefix=/opt/bacula \
--with-dir-user=bacula \
--with-dir-group=bacula \
--with-sd-user=bacula \
--with-sd-group=bacula \
--with-fd-user=root \
--with-fd-group=bacula \
--enable-smartalloc \
--sbindir=/opt/bacula/bin \
--sysconfdir=/opt/bacula/etc \
--with-subsys-dir=/opt/bacula/var \
--with-working-dir=/opt/bacula/var/bacula/working \
--with-pid-dir=/opt/bacula/var \
--with-logdir=/opt/bacula/var \
--with-archivedir=/opt/bacula/var \
--with-mysql=/opt/mysql \
--with-openssl
and it's working fine so far. Your issue may be related to the
"disable-libtool" parameter you provided. Can you try to build it
without this disable parameter.
Thank you Daniel, removing "--disable-libtool" allowed it to build, why
whoever disabled it didn't make configure barf on it is something I can
only wonder about.
And in some further fiddling about I found that replacing "NO_ECHO = @"
with "NO_ECHO =" in the makefiles makes it *much* easier to work out
just what is going wrong. Hiding information just makes life difficult.
